MySQL的数据库文件格式是指MySQL数据库引擎用来存储数据的文件格式。MySQL支持多种数据库引擎,每种引擎都有不同的文件格式。
- MyISAM文件格式:
- 概念:MyISAM是MySQL最常用的数据库引擎之一,它使用表级锁定,适用于读写比较少的应用。
- 优势:具有快速插入和查询的特点,并支持全文索引和压缩功能。
- 应用场景:适合于静态数据或只读数据的存储,如博客文章、新闻、日志等。
- 推荐的腾讯云产品:云数据库CynosDB(MySQL版)
- 产品介绍:https://cloud.tencent.com/product/cynosdb
- InnoDB文件格式:
- 概念:InnoDB是MySQL默认的数据库引擎,支持事务和行级锁定,适用于高并发读写的应用。
- 优势:具有良好的事务支持、崩溃恢复能力和并发性能,支持外键约束和行级锁定。
- 应用场景:适合于数据写入较多、并发读取需求较高的应用,如电子商务、论坛、社交网络等。
- 推荐的腾讯云产品:云数据库TencentDB for MySQL
- 产品介绍:https://cloud.tencent.com/product/tcdb-mysql
- CSV文件格式:
- 概念:CSV是一种纯文本文件格式,以逗号分隔字段值,适用于数据交换和导入导出操作。
- 优势:简单易用,适合处理大量的结构化数据,支持多种软件和工具的导入导出。
- 应用场景:常用于数据的备份、迁移和与其他系统之间的数据交换。
- 推荐的腾讯云产品:云数据库CynosDB(MySQL版)
- 产品介绍:https://cloud.tencent.com/product/cynosdb
以上是针对MySQL的部分数据库文件格式的概念、优势、应用场景以及推荐的腾讯云相关产品。请注意,腾讯云是一家领先的云计算服务提供商,提供了全面的云计算解决方案,包括数据库服务、存储服务、人工智能等。